<h5>1. Upgrade Your Hosting for Performance</h5>
<p>As your store grows, shared hosting may no longer be enough. Here’s what to do:</p>
<ul>
<li>Move to VPS or cloud hosting for more power</li>
<li>Use hosting optimized for WooCommerce</li>
<li>Choose servers located in or near the UAE for faster load times</li>
</ul>
<p>A faster site means better user experience and more conversions—especially for Dubai shoppers who expect speed.</p>
<h5>2. Use Lightweight and Optimized Themes</h5>
<p>Heavy themes can slow your store down. For better performance:</p>
<ul>
<li>Use WooCommerce-compatible, fast-loading themes</li>
<li>Avoid themes with too many built-in features you don’t need</li>
<li>Customize only what’s necessary for branding</li>
</ul>
<p>Remember, <a href="https://ecommercedesign.ae/woocommerce/how-to-redesign-your-woocommerce-site-without-losing-traffic/"><strong>How to Redesign Your WooCommerce Site Without Losing Traffic</strong></a> should be your approach whenever making design changes—especially during scaling.</p>
<h5>3. Add More Features Without Slowing Down</h5>
<p>As your needs grow, you’ll want more features. But plugins can slow down your site. Here’s how to manage that:</p>
<ul>
<li>Only install high-quality, well-coded plugins</li>
<li>Remove unused plugins and themes</li>
<li>Regularly update plugins and WooCommerce core</li>
</ul>
<p>Some useful scalable plugins include:</p>
<ul>
<li>Advanced product filters</li>
<li>Smart search</li>
<li>Bulk product editors</li>
<li>Shipping and tax automation tools</li>
</ul>
<h5><strong>4. Optimize for Mobile Shoppers in the UAE</strong></h5>
<p>With many shoppers in Dubai and the UAE using smartphones, mobile optimization is crucial. Tips:</p>
<ul>
<li>Use a mobile-first design</li>
<li>Test your store on different devices</li>
<li>Enable accelerated mobile pages (AMP)</li>
</ul>
<p>This makes your store fast and easy to use for mobile visitors, improving both sales and SEO.</p>
<h5>5. Make Checkout Fast and Frictionless</h5>
<p>A slow or complicated checkout process can lose sales. As you scale:</p>
<ul>
<li>Offer one-click checkout options</li>
<li>Accept local payment gateways like Telr, PayTabs, or Tabby</li>
<li>Use address auto-complete features</li>
</ul>
<p>This not only improves the experience but also increases conversions for UAE shoppers.</p>
<h5>6. Focus on Scalable Inventory and Product Management</h5>
<p>As you grow, so does your inventory. Tips to manage this effectively:</p>
<ul>
<li>Use product bundles and variations smartly</li>
<li>Implement inventory management plugins</li>
<li>Connect your store to warehouse or ERP systems</li>
</ul>
<p>Automating these parts will help you handle more orders with ease.</p>
<h5>7. Boost Site Speed with Caching and CDN</h5>
<p>Speed is a key part of scalability. To boost performance:</p>
<ul>
<li>Use caching plugins like WP Rocket or W3 Total Cache</li>
<li>Use a CDN (Content Delivery Network) like Cloudflare</li>
<li>Compress images and minify code (HTML, CSS, JS)</li>
</ul>
<p>Fast-loading websites keep customers engaged and improve SEO rankings in the UAE market.</p>
<h5>8. Improve Security as You Scale</h5>
<p>More orders mean more data and more risk. Strengthen your WooCommerce security by:</p>
<ul>
<li>Using SSL certificates</li>
<li>Installing security plugins like Wordfence or Sucuri</li>
<li>Enabling two-factor authentication</li>
<li>Regularly scanning for malware</li>
</ul>
<p>Trust is vital, especially for growing brands in Dubai and the UAE.</p>
<h5>9. Plan for International Expansion</h5>
<p>Scaling also means targeting global markets. Here’s how WooCommerce helps:</p>
<ul>
<li>Add multilingual support (Arabic + English for UAE, plus more)</li>
<li>Enable international shipping options</li>
<li>Use currency switcher plugins</li>
</ul>
<p>Always ensure your store complies with local and global regulations during expansion.</p>
<h5>10. Use Data to Guide Your Growth</h5>
<p>As your store grows, decisions should be data-driven. Use tools like:</p>
<ul>
<li>Google Analytics</li>
<li>WooCommerce reports</li>
<li>Heatmaps and user behavior tracking</li>
</ul>
<p>This helps you improve your product pages, optimize campaigns, and adjust your marketing strategy based on real user actions.</p>

<h2>Step-by-Step Guide to Migrating to WooCommerce</h2>
<p>Here’s a simplified process to help you transition smoothly:</p>
<h5>1. Set Up Your WordPress and WooCommerce Site</h5>
<ul>
<li>Choose a reliable WordPress host</li>
<li>Install WordPress and WooCommerce plugin</li>
<li>Configure store settings (currency, taxes, shipping)</li>
</ul>
<h5>2. Export Your Data</h5>
<ul>
<li>Export products, orders, and customer data from Shopify or Magento</li>
<li>Use built-in tools or export in CSV/XML format</li>
</ul>
<h5>3. Use Migration Tools or Plugins</h5>
<ul>
<li>Consider tools like Cart2Cart or FG Magento to WooCommerce</li>
<li>These automate much of the transfer and reduce errors</li>
</ul>
<h5>4. Import Your Data into WooCommerce</h5>
<ul>
<li>Upload product info, images, categories</li>
<li>Check for missing data or formatting issues</li>
</ul>
<h5>5. Set Up Design and Theme</h5>
<ul>
<li>Choose a WooCommerce-compatible theme</li>
<li>Customize with your brand colors and fonts</li>
</ul>
<h5>6. Add Necessary Plugins</h5>
<ul>
<li>SEO plugin (like Rank Math or Yoast)</li>
<li>Payment gateways for the UAE market</li>
<li>Security plugins like Wordfence</li>
</ul>
<h5>7. Test Everything</h5>
<ul>
<li>Test your checkout, product pages, and mobile responsiveness</li>
<li>Ensure all links are working</li>
</ul>
<h2>Common Challenges to Watch Out For</h2>
<p>During migration, you might face:</p>
<ul>
<li>Data mismatches</li>
<li>SEO ranking drops (temporary)</li>
<li>Compatibility issues with themes/plugins</li>
</ul>
<p>To avoid problems, consider working with a UAE-based WooCommerce expert who understands the local market and regulations.</p>

<h2>Step 1: Do a Full Website Audit</h2>
<p>Before you start changing anything:</p>
<ul>
<li>Check your current traffic sources</li>
<li>Identify your top-performing pages and keywords</li>
<li>Audit your product pages, SEO setup, and plugins</li>
</ul>
<p><img src="https://s.w.org/images/core/emoji/17.0.2/72x72/2705.png" alt="✅" class="wp-smiley" style="height: 1em; max-height: 1em;" /> <em>Use tools like Google Analytics and Google Search Console to understand what’s working.</em></p>
<p>This step ensures that you don’t accidentally lose your valuable content or ranking pages.</p>
<h2>Step 2: Keep the Same URL Structure (If Possible)</h2>
<p>One of the biggest mistakes during a WooCommerce redesign is changing URLs.</p>
<ul>
<li>Keep product and category URLs the same</li>
<li>If you must change them, set up <strong>301 redirects</strong> properly</li>
<li>Avoid broken links or deleted pages</li>
</ul>
<p><img src="https://s.w.org/images/core/emoji/17.0.2/72x72/2705.png" alt="✅" class="wp-smiley" style="height: 1em; max-height: 1em;" /> This helps search engines understand that your content has moved and preserves your rankings.</p>
<h2>Step 3: Backup Everything</h2>
<p>Never start a redesign without a full backup of your website.</p>
<ul>
<li>Use plugins like UpdraftPlus or Jetpack</li>
<li>Save your WooCommerce database, images, and settings</li>
<li>Test the redesign on a staging site before going live</li>
</ul>
<p>A backup gives you peace of mind and a fallback option if anything breaks.</p>

<h2>Step 5: Keep SEO Elements Intact</h2>
<p>SEO is crucial during a redesign. Be sure to:</p>
<ul>
<li>Maintain meta titles and descriptions</li>
<li>Use proper heading structure (H1, H2, etc.)</li>
<li>Add schema markup for products, reviews, etc.</li>
</ul>
<p><img src="https://s.w.org/images/core/emoji/17.0.2/72x72/2705.png" alt="✅" class="wp-smiley" style="height: 1em; max-height: 1em;" /> Remember: <strong>“<a href="https://ecommercedesign.ae/woocommerce/how-structured-data-helps-your-woocommerce-site-rank-better/">How Structured Data Helps Your WooCommerce Site Rank Better</a>”</strong> is an important part of SEO. Make sure structured data remains in your new design.</p>
<h2>Step 6: Improve Site Speed</h2>
<p>A redesign is a great time to optimize loading speed.</p>
<h5>Tips to improve speed:</h5>
<ul>
<li>Use compressed images and lazy loading</li>
<li>Switch to a faster hosting provider</li>
<li>Use caching plugins like WP Rocket</li>
<li>Minimize scripts and styles</li>
</ul>
<p>Users in the UAE expect fast websites, especially on mobile. A faster site also helps improve your Google rankings.</p>
<h2>Step 7: Mobile-First Design</h2>
<p>Make sure your new WooCommerce design looks perfect on mobile devices.</p>
<h5>Key mobile-friendly features:</h5>
<ul>
<li>Touch-friendly buttons</li>
<li>Clear menus</li>
<li>Fast loading on 3G/4G</li>
<li>Easy checkout process</li>
</ul>
<p>Most shoppers in Dubai use smartphones to shop. Your site must give them a smooth experience.</p>
<h2>Step 8: Migrate Content Carefully</h2>
<p>Don’t lose valuable blog posts, product descriptions, or SEO text.</p>
<ul>
<li>Use migration tools or plugins</li>
<li>Keep internal links updated</li>
<li>Double-check images and media files</li>
</ul>
<p><img src="https://s.w.org/images/core/emoji/17.0.2/72x72/2705.png" alt="✅" class="wp-smiley" style="height: 1em; max-height: 1em;" /> Use the redesign as a chance to rewrite weak product descriptions and add fresh SEO content.</p>
